Barn owl population. As of 2010 the presumed western population was approximately 250-1000 mature barn owls COSEWIC 2010. At the same time the estimated amount of mature barn owls found in Ontario the eastern population was a maximum of twenty COSEWIC 2010. The main reason explaining the decline in population size is the intensification of farming practices causing a reduction of the quality of foraging habitats and nest sites the two key factors determining Barn Owl population dynamics De Bruijn 1994.
